Transaction e4043c045bd4515ff78934cd68def05d14dae2ae0c5eb56d38825446f4b68941
1 Input
1 Output
-
e4043c045bd4515ff78934cd68def05d14dae2ae0c5eb56d38825446f4b68941:0
- value
- 3060198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28b3e7da18db1d71e1f4089c3d6462f19343de46 OP_EQUAL
- address
- 35QEUHKVsyqrfYvudxn5B5Hg1U8Q4uZRwk